Auto merge of #109119 - lcnr:trait-system-cleanup, r=compiler-errors
a general type system cleanup removes the helper functions `traits::fully_solve_X` as they add more complexity then they are worth. It's confusing which of these helpers should be used in which context. changes the way we deal with overflow to always add depth in `evaluate_predicates_recursively`. It may make sense to actually fully transition to not have `recursion_depth` on obligations but that's probably a bit too much for this PR. also removes some other small - and imo unnecessary - helpers. r? types
